Medical Events in North AmericaCreator:Corcos, Lucille Date/Date Range Produced: 1950 Language:English Region Depicted:United States Map Type:Historical mapsPictorial maps Dimensions: 53cm x 77 cm Historical Context: Map shows the progress of medicine and accomplishments in the field by numerous scientists of the late nineteenth and early twentieth centuries. Abbott Laboratories which used this as a promotion for its pharmaceuticals was founded in 1888 by Dr. Wallace C. Abbott of Chicago. During World War II it led an effort to ramp up production of penicillin. It continues to focus on a variety of general pharmaceuticals. Map Showing the Distribution of the Slave Population of the Southern States of the United StatesCreator:Hergesheimer, Edwin Publisher:U.S. Coast and Geodetic Survey Date/Date Range Produced: 1861 Language:English Region Depicted:United States Dimensions: 1 map: 81 cm x 102 cm on sheet; 69 cm x 87 cm neat line Historical Context: Map depicts the uneven distribution of slaveholdings in the border and southern states. Each county is shaded to reflect the density of the enslaved population; the darker the county is shaded the higher percentage of enslaved persons with the darkest shade indicating counties in which more than 80% of the population was enslaved.
